Dear all,
I need some insight into this question.
On Tier-1 General Dependant Application Form, http://ukba.homeoffice.gov.uk/siteconte ... ation1.pdf, if we read question E8, it says:
E8. Have you ever been refused entry clearance/visa or leave to enter or remain in the UK?
YES or NO.
Let me explain you my scenario before I can decide to write YES or No in this case.
I have to apply for Tier-1 extension along with my two dependants as they are here with me.
============================
My wife and daughter applied as dependents of Tier-1 migrant in Dec-2010. Their application was rejected under Appendix E 319c (g): http://www.ukba.homeoffice.gov.uk/polic ... 1migrants/
It says as follows
You have applied with your daughter; therefore, you need to show evidence of £3200.
You have not provided a bank statement with your application. Therefore, you have failed to provide any evidence showing that your sponsor has these funds available.
It says you can appeal for the decision using Appeal Form IAFT-2, which can be sent to Visa Section of British Embassy in Abu Dhabi.
At that time, we did attached bank statement but somehow entry clearance officer didn't see it as it was just one page bank statement.
Later on, we applied for "appeal review requests" for her and our daughter and the decision was overturned and they got visas within a month after the appeal.
============================
Now, my question is how should I respond to this question E8 in Tier-1 dependant Application Form. Should I say YES or NO?
